Cost-Effective Sourcing of Piperidin-3-one Hydrochloride from Manufacturers
For organizations involved in pharmaceutical development and chemical synthesis, managing costs without compromising on quality is a continuous challenge. Piperidin-3-one Hydrochloride (CAS: 61644-00-6) is a prime example of an intermediate where strategic sourcing can yield significant cost savings. Understanding how to buy effectively from manufacturers is key to optimizing your budget.
Direct sourcing from manufacturers, particularly those in established chemical production hubs like China, often presents the most cost-effective approach. These manufacturers typically have streamlined production processes and economies of scale, allowing them to offer competitive prices for Piperidin-3-one Hydrochloride. Engaging with these suppliers directly can eliminate intermediary markups, providing better value.
When looking to purchase Piperidin-3-one Hydrochloride, it's beneficial to gather quotes from multiple reputable manufacturers. Comparing not only the price per kilogram but also the associated shipping costs, payment terms, and minimum order quantities is crucial for a comprehensive cost analysis. A supplier's ability to offer bulk discounts can further enhance cost-effectiveness for larger procurement needs.
Beyond the unit price, consider the total cost of ownership. This includes the reliability of supply, the consistency of product quality (ensuring minimal batch rejection), and the efficiency of the logistics. A slightly higher initial price from a highly reliable supplier might prove more cost-effective in the long run by preventing delays and production issues.
Furthermore, staying informed about market trends and raw material costs can help in timing purchases for optimal pricing. Building strong relationships with trusted manufacturers allows for better negotiation leverage and potentially preferential pricing or early access to supply.
Ultimately, achieving cost-effectiveness when buying Piperidin-3-one Hydrochloride involves a strategic approach that balances price, quality, and supplier reliability. By focusing on direct engagement with manufacturers and conducting thorough due diligence, procurement professionals can secure this vital intermediate efficiently and economically.
